Audun Hetland is a researcher at the University of Tromsø who specializes in avalanche survival. He recently provided insights regarding the extraordinary case of a man who survived an avalanche for seven hours, noting that such prolonged survival is almost unique and contrary to typical expectations, as most avalanche victims asphyxiate within minutes.
